Most of the advice is good, though not particularly different from an advice you would give about writing any essays. This one though:
> Avoid placing equations in the middle of sentences. Mathematics is not the same as English, and we shouldn’t pretend it is.
I don't know what to make of it. Equations are supposed to be part of sentences, and mathematical equations are compact expressions of relations. For example, the sentence,
Newton taught us that force is equal to mass times acceleration, where both mass and accelerations are inertial quantities.
can be compacted as
Newton taught us that $F=ma$, where both the mass $m$ and acceleration $a$ are inertial quantities.
This becomes more useful with more complex relations. Generally, hanging mathematical expressions (those independent of sentences) should be avoided to the utmost in any technical report.
Yes, this is just bad advice if your audience is fluent in mathematical notation.
There's another piece of advice that is bad for formal mathematical writing:
> And don’t use the same word repeatedly — it’s boring.
If the word has a formal definition, this is bad advice. For example, in a game theory setting, we might say there are n agents. If we start calling the agents players, people, etc., it can get confusing, especially if there are other entities involved besides the agents (such as a mechanism designer or so on).

I like a lot of the advice here, except
> Keep sentences short, simply constructed and direct. Concise, clear sentences work well for scientific explanations. Minimize clauses, compound sentences and transition words — such as ‘however’ or ‘thus’ — so that the reader can focus on the main message.
Repetitive sentence structure is not engaging and lulls a reader to sleep, no matter the context. Clauses and transition words and nontrivial sentence structure allow for qualification and clarification, juxtaposition and contrast, and emphasis, often with many fewer words than if written as a series of single independent clauses. A short sentence following longer ones punctuates its point and can effectively lead into subsequent sentences that express more complex ideas/explanations.
In my own scientific writing I also frequently use compound sentences to indicate that the ideas are related (causally or otherwise). It's also unclear to me how one could more efficiently communicate logical or causal flow between ideas than with transition words like "thus" or "therefore."
